Mossad spy executed in Iran for wartime collaboration with Israel

Koorosh Keivani, an agent of Israeli spy agency Mossad

Koorosh Keivani, an agent of Israeli spy agency Mossad who sent photos and videos of important security locations from of Iran to Israel, has been executed, according to Iran’s judiciary.

In a statement on Sunday, Iran’s Supreme Court said Keivani was executed after the proper legal procedures.

He was arrested by the Islamic Revolution Guards Corps (IRGC) Intelligence Organization last June, when the Israeli regime and the US waged the 12-day war against Iran.

During his arrest, He had in his possession a Padra van, a motorcycle, and several highly-advanced spying apparatuses.

He had been recruited in Sweden in 2023 by a Mossad agent by the name of “Ben” who could speak Farsi.

After that, Keivani traveled to several European countries, becoming more familiar with his hander Ben and receiving large sums of money.

Finally, he traveled to Tel Aviv for two weeks for receiving the necessary instructions on how to take photos and videos from critical locations across Iran.

The court sentenced him to death based on the defendant’s confessions, the IRGC’s information gathered from his emails and other sources, the advanced spying apparatuses the defendant had.
